333 Commits

Author SHA1 Message Date
toddouska
4d719897a5 Merge branch 'master' of github.com:cyassl/cyassl 2012-10-22 17:29:19 -07:00
toddouska
aef97af361 make rabbit optional with configure option 2012-10-22 17:28:46 -07:00
John Safranek
5a421c04e7 Merge branch 'master' of github.com:cyassl/cyassl 2012-10-22 14:50:02 -07:00
John Safranek
d78770c1e5 change null cipher to allow different buffers 2012-10-22 14:48:27 -07:00
toddouska
cb08eb672e Merge branch 'master' of https://github.com/BrianAker/cyassl 2012-10-22 10:56:53 -07:00
John Safranek
a92b639155 add optional null cipher support for RSA 2012-10-19 20:52:22 -07:00
Brian Aker
b883cc55a4 Fix rules around pthread usage to fix clang warning. 2012-10-19 20:09:17 -07:00
toddouska
a5d7a3ea8f fix opensslExtra with psk server example, add psk to commit tests 2012-10-19 12:54:15 -07:00
toddouska
c974d77213 add shorten 64 to 32 warnings back on with fixes 2012-10-19 12:44:23 -07:00
John Safranek
346a52a58c add optional null cipher support for PSK 2012-10-19 10:37:21 -07:00
John Safranek
e673b1852a fixed windows build warnings 2012-10-09 16:13:05 -07:00
toddouska
4a739f6bc7 sniffer handshake state fix for sanity checks 2012-10-05 13:39:11 -07:00
toddouska
57e7e28d6d Merge branch 'master' of github.com:cyassl/cyassl 2012-10-03 17:10:05 -07:00
toddouska
9ca07d1f4d dtls may have different first handshake message 2012-10-03 17:09:45 -07:00
John Safranek
0d80343073 Merge branch 'master' of github.com:cyassl/cyassl 2012-10-03 16:53:55 -07:00
toddouska
257d10a69f sanity check for out of order handshake messages 2012-10-03 16:44:08 -07:00
toddouska
66c95b0c15 DoAppData sanity check for handshake complete 2012-10-03 16:36:00 -07:00
John Safranek
397fbb743f Merge branch 'master' of github.com:cyassl/cyassl 2012-10-03 15:33:23 -07:00
John Safranek
95a30e3f0a windows bug fix on dtls retry 2012-10-03 15:29:28 -07:00
toddouska
e970cdfbc0 init cipher specs, check client key exchange state b4 process 2012-10-03 11:57:20 -07:00
John Safranek
9bbca6acfb Merge branch 'master' of github.com:cyassl/cyassl 2012-10-02 14:42:06 -07:00
John Safranek
6d1e485ef4 DTLS to use recvfrom and sendto in embed recv and send callbacks. Added support for storing dtls peer address. 2012-10-02 09:15:50 -07:00
toddouska
36eeab927b fix sniffer assert comparison on newer gcc 2012-10-01 13:16:37 -07:00
toddouska
e0413df92a add key setup flag for malicious or misbehaving handshake messages with new memory system 2012-10-01 11:32:05 -07:00
toddouska
e5c04e70a7 make sure existing nonblocking users still work 2012-09-28 15:10:35 -07:00
toddouska
dd421ebb7d cleaner sniffer mem fix 2012-09-28 11:04:20 -07:00
toddouska
30bec6c193 fix sniffer out of memory potential problem 2012-09-28 10:58:33 -07:00
John Safranek
dfb84dff37 added accessors for CYASSL members for use in send/recv callbacks 2012-09-25 15:51:56 -07:00
John Safranek
cd0226924a Merge branch 'master' of github.com:cyassl/cyassl 2012-09-21 16:37:34 -07:00
John Safranek
9643e58dad fixed bug for Windows build 2012-09-21 16:36:48 -07:00
toddouska
4e19c234f4 fix new warnings on linux64 2012-09-21 13:29:04 -07:00
John Safranek
c3aedc940f improved dtls retry on connect 2012-09-21 09:36:01 -07:00
John Safranek
08a3423f43 changed error return code for dtls functions to NOT_COMPILED_IN 2012-09-19 09:09:27 -07:00
John Safranek
059db7f69c check the return code of DtlsPoolSave() 2012-09-18 16:00:30 -07:00
John Safranek
d1068d25d1 fixed another compile warning 2012-09-18 12:05:16 -07:00
John Safranek
68cb6044cb Merge branch 'master' of github.com:cyassl/cyassl 2012-09-18 11:41:25 -07:00
John Safranek
989d7f4aad fixed windows build warning 2012-09-18 11:11:45 -07:00
toddouska
f6c5bf032d update sniffer more memory changes 2012-09-18 09:08:40 -07:00
John Safranek
d1baa9f541 Merge branch 'master' of github.com:cyassl/cyassl 2012-09-18 08:46:11 -07:00
toddouska
53ccbddd01 allow meta PEM data at end of file too 2012-09-17 17:25:38 -07:00
John Safranek
88bba146ae fixed bug with handshake defragmentation and ordering 2012-09-17 11:32:36 -07:00
John Safranek
40eb5b3cc5 DTLS resend allocates only enough buffer when needed 2012-09-17 09:52:20 -07:00
John Safranek
40972868ce fix merge conflicts 2012-09-14 21:19:06 -07:00
John Safranek
7899252104 dtls handshake improvement 2012-09-14 19:30:50 -07:00
John Safranek
56ee2eaba8 added dtls message retry 2012-09-14 09:35:34 -07:00
John Safranek
97ca8439a4 Merge branch 'master' of github.com:cyassl/cyassl 2012-09-07 08:30:03 -07:00
John Safranek
407397e8be adding DTLS retry timeout, added CYASSL pointer to recv/send callbacks 2012-09-06 22:41:55 -07:00
toddouska
8c32a5a2ed make RNG in ssl dynamic, release after hs if stream or < tls1.1 2012-09-05 16:18:29 -07:00
toddouska
9ddf43268d use dynamic memory for ssl ciphers, only use what needed 2012-09-05 12:30:51 -07:00
toddouska
c47afaf84f make suites object dynamic, only use during handshake 2012-09-05 10:17:48 -07:00